A 3D general circulation model with free surface is used for the nowcast system.The bottom slope is quite large and the baroclinic effect is strong in the Taiwan Strait, justifying the choice of a z-level model over a sigma-coordinate model (e.g., POM). Five major tidal constituents O1, K1, N2, M2 and S2 were run together in the model.

SummarySummary

• In the first stage of model development, barotropic tides were successfully simulated in a hindcast mode.

• The model performed well as the open boundary conditions were determined using either an adjoint model or a larger-domain two-dimensional model results.

• The coexistence of a southward propagating Kelvin wave and a nearly standing wave respectively in the eastern and western halves of the Taiwan Strait has also been examined using the model.

Future workFuture work

• The two approaches of determining open boundary conditions will be adopted when the model is used in an operational mode.

• The wind-driven part, remote-controlled larger-scale circulation and buoyancy-driven circulation will be incorporated in the model step by step.

• The observational work will include strait-wide hydrographic surveys, current measurements using bottom-mounted ADCP moorings and real-time sea-level observations.
